Data Visualization-Customer Experience Analytics - Senior Associate

Job Description

    About Data & Analytics: CCB s Data & Analytics Team unifies data and analytics talent across Chase to responsibly leverage data to build competitive advantages for our businesses with value and protection for customers. The team encompasses a variety of data and analytics disciplines, from data governance and data strategy/partnerships to reporting, data science and machine learning, and are actively engaged in ensuring impact at the front-line and for our customers through Sales, Marketing and Operations transformations. We have a strong partnership with our dedicated Technology partners, who provide us with our cutting edge data and analytics infrastructure. Joining CCB Data & Analytics means you sit in the engine that powers Chase with insights, providing an opportunity to materially impact both our customer and business outcomes. The team also offers significant learning and mobility opportunities for career development and future growth. Position Overview: Chase is on a mission to deliver a customer-obsessed experience by improving clock speed and providing first-class customer interactions. Across the organization we are all committed to transforming the way we work and how we deliver value against our business objectives. We favor rapid, iterative design to once and done project work and prefer new design to improving on the status quo, all in a way that allows us to plug and play instead of depending on outdated technology builds. To achieve that mission, we have launched cross-functional customer journey teams that enable us to continuously design, deliver and validate new functionality and foster an environment where we can quickly improve the customer experience.The Data Visualization Analytics Senior Associate is part of the Customer Experience Analytics (within CCB Data & Analytics organization). This dynamic position will be focused on cross-channel and cross-product analytics and data visualization; that is, focused on analyzing our customers experience across various card and retail product and lines of business, designing and building dashboards with Tableau, visualizing data and insights for the executives, and driving our business growth by providing innovative ideas and actionable insights.Our business is based on a strong culture of highly-informed decision-making. As such, the successful candidate will be one who is able to scan across a large ecosystem of data, research, and convert data to meaningful insights and smart dashboards, in order to develop and influence critical initiatives across teams and channels.You will serve as an expert in leveraging the agile process to deliver on a wide range of business and product-focused visualizations including building and maintaining smart dashboards, exploratory analysis to identify product enhancement and automation opportunities and crafting data stories and presentations of key findings to stakeholders. You will also leverage enterprise data to develop the right automated data solutions using a mix of customer, account, digital, telephony, financial and operational data. You will have the opportunity to work collaboratively with partners such as Service Product Group, Claims & Disputes Product organization, Machine Learning and Intelligence Operations, Finance, Marketing, Area Product Owners, Operations specialists, and other analytics teams across CCB. Key Responsibilities include:
    • Design, develop, and maintain product/non product Ops Analytics dashboards for the Strategic Insights group and teams across CCB Ops and Product teams using data visualization tools such as Tableau, Adobe Analytics and other BI tools
    • Ability to perform data analytics using Alteryx/SQL/Python and hands on experience in investigative and prescriptive analytics
    • Interpret and analyze the insights from Tableau-based dashboards & interactive analytic suites to identify and present actionable opportunities and monitor the comparative effectiveness of various initiatives across teams
    • Package and present data and insights in an executive and visualized format. Prepare and automate the data needed for Tableau dashboards, including any statistically derived metrics or benchmarks; and uses multiple analytic tools and data sources to support those objectives, including Tableau, Alteryx, Python, SQL, and Excel.
    • Pro-actively identify key growth areas and opportunities and communicate recommendations to the leadership team and various operation and strategy teams across the firm to influence and fine-tune our ops strategies.
    • Collaborate with cross-functional strategy teams to design and deliver customized analyses and strategic roadmaps, and synthesize the data into actionable insights to influence and drive business across CCB D&A organization
    • Support & lead partnerships with key Ops stakeholders and Ops Product groups with strong understanding of business drivers, underlying data and processes
    • Analyze customer interactions and events across a variety of channels (calls, branch, online, mobile) to better understand customer journeys and friction points
    • Prepare and deliver presentations summarizing sharp insights and conclusions, often for executives, leadership teams and business partners in regularly-scheduled analytics meetings chaired by the analyst in this role
    • Support the creation of automated visualizations using Tableau, Adobe Analytics, to measure the impact of implemented products and provide management with self-service tools to explore and report on current trends of key metrics
    • Embrace a growth and learning mindset; proactive and creative; collaborative, team-oriented and client-focused; motivated by business and technical challenges
    Qualifications and Required Skills:
    • 8-10 years of related experience in data visualization, analytics and data driven strategy roles
    • Bachelors degree in a quantitative discipline such as business, finance, economics, engineering, statistics, information system, or mathematics; Master s degree in a STEM field preferred
    • Able to communicate effectively with Senior leaders to enable collaboration, decision-making, and transparency, with great presentation skills
    • Strong Tableau and Tableau Server knowledge and skills; other visualization designing tools such as Illustrator, Adobe Analytics or equivalent is a plus
    • Excellent analytical ability as well as hands-on experience with analytical and statistical packages/databases (e.g. Alteryx, SQL or equivalent); experience with big data technologies and machine learning is a plus
    • Ability to analyze, interpret and translate metric performances into insights and recommendations, and package and present projections, performance trends, and performance outlooks in an executive format
    • Experience with data automation or data wrangling ETL tools such as Alteryx, Trifecta or equivalent
    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ills
    • Demonstrated experience in analyzing voluminous data from raw sources
    • Ability to conduct research into data mining issues, practices, and products as required
    • Demonstrated problem solving skills, especially in a fast-paced environment
    • Understanding of the key drivers within the customer journey across card, retail and auto lines of business is preferred
    • Self-motivated, goal-oriented, and able to manage and deliver in an innovation-driven and fast-paced environment
    • Should have a very good understanding of IT processes and databases. Should be able to work directly with data owners/custodians and contribute in building analytics data hub
    • Flexibility/adaptability, ability to listen and defend or change direction based upon team and stakeholder consensus
    • Superior judgment to mitigate risk, and to foster an environment where risk/control issues are escalated and trends are anticipated and identified
    • Acting with integrity, and protecting our company, clients and customers
